Improving diagnosis and management of pre-eclampsia
Pre-eclampsia is a condition that affects women usually during the second half of pregnancy . It causes high blood pressure and protein in the urine and , if not diagnosed and closely monitored , it can lead to potentially life-threatening complications . The development of pre-eclampsia is varied and has historically been difficult to definitively identify or rule out .
Placental Growth Factor ( PlGF ) testing is a simple blood test that eliminates the risk of poor prediction of pre-eclampsia and reduces the risk of unnecessary hospitalisation for women who will not go on to develop the condition . This creates the potential to free up hospital beds and provides both an improved patient experience and wellbeing and financial benefit for the NHS .
We have been working with all maternity services in the region to implement PlGF testing with the aim of providing equitable care for all women across Yorkshire and the Humber .
From April 2020 to March 2021
• Seven trusts have implemented the test across the region
• We are supporting three trusts with trial evaluations
• 1,470 blood tests have been taken
